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.
2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Things must not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you're done.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Simply let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ure you have plenty of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.
40 yard dumpster measurements
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't totally conventional from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that a lot of dumpster firms normally rent, so it's ideal for large residential projects as well as for commercial and industrial use.
A 40 yard container will hold between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container include:
-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able home
- A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
- New construction or a major improvement to a substantial home
- Sizeable am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and garbage

Can I Use a Roll-off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as allow roll off dumpsters. When you have a driveway, then you could normally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by putting it upon the road.
Some jobs, however, will necessitate putting the dumpster on the road. If this applies to you, then you definitely should speak to your city to find out whether you need to get any permits before renting the dumpster. In most cases, cities will allow you to keep a dumpster on a residential road for a brief quantity of time. In case you believe you'll need to be sure that it stays on the road for a number of weeks or months, however, you may need to get a license.
Contacting your local permits and licensing office is generally recommended. Even supposing it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ll realize that you simply are following the law.
What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Austin?
Residential clean outs usually do not demand big dumpsters. The size that you need, though, will be contingent on the size of the project.
Should you plan to clean out the entire home, then you likely need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You could also use this size for a big cellar or loft clean out.
In case you only need to clean out a room or two, then you certainly may want to choose a 10-yard dumpster.
When selecting a dumpster, though, it's frequently wise to ask for a size larger than that which you think you will need. Unless you're a professional, it's difficult to estimate the precise size needed for your job. By getting a slightly larger size, you spend a little more money, however you also prevent the possibility that you will run out of room. Renting a larger dumpster is nearly always cheaper than renting two little ones.

If you have a job you are going to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your trash and crap for you, or in case you should just rent a dumpster in Austin and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ative in case you would like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you also don't m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also function nicely in the event that you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ll-offs typically start at 10 cubic yards, thus if you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for a lot more dumpster than you need.
Garbage or crap removal makes more sense in case you would like someone else to load your old things. It also works nicely if you would like it to be taken away quickly so it's outside of your hair, or in the event that you only have a few large things; this is likely c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.

What's the smallest size dumpster available?
The smallest size roll off dumpster typically available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equal to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great choice for small-scale jobs, such as small home c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function well for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or soil removal Getting rid of rubbish Bear in mind that weight limitations for the containers are demanded,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ional fees. The normal we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in can help you take good care of small jobs around the house. For those who have a larger project coming up, take a peek at some larger containers also.
